目的探讨Visfatin在油酸诱导的SW872成熟脂肪细胞胰岛素抵抗(IR)中的作用。方法体外培养SW872前脂肪细胞,当细胞完全汇合后,加入0.6mmol·L-1油酸诱导分化48h,此时SW872前脂肪细胞被诱导分化为成熟脂肪细胞,以SW872成熟脂肪细胞为研究对象,采用1.0mmol·L-1油酸诱导SW872成熟脂肪细胞产生IR。将其分为正常对照组(成熟SW872脂肪细胞)和IR组(采用1.0mmol·L-1油酸诱导SW872成熟脂肪细胞产生IR)。采用2-脱氧-[3H]-右旋葡萄糖掺入法检测2组SW872成熟脂肪细胞基础状态(基础状态组)、Visfatin和Insulin刺激状态(Visfatin和Insulin刺激组)下的葡萄糖转运能力。结果1.在正常对照组中,Visfatin和Insulin刺激组SW872成熟脂肪细胞葡萄糖转运率显著增加,分别是基础状态组的1.10倍(P<0.01)和1.34倍(P<0.01)。2.在IR组中,SW872成熟脂肪细胞的葡萄糖转运率均显著下降。与正常对照组比较,Visfatin刺激组和基础状态组的葡萄糖转运率分别减少12.30%(P<0.01)和9.73%(P<0.0...  相似文献

目的观察急性心肌梗死患者血清内脏脂肪素(简称内脂素)水平变化及其与冠状动脉病变严重程度和心脏功能的关系,并探讨其临床意义。方法选择急诊行经皮冠状动脉介入治疗的急性心肌梗死(AMI)患者作为观察组(AMI组,n=30),其中男性22例,女性8例,平均年龄为54.77±10.09岁,其冠状动脉病变程度根据冠状动脉病变支数及Gensini积分进行评估;另选同期行冠状动脉造影检查正常者作为对照组(n=30),其中男性20例,女性10例,平均年龄为54.07±11.07岁。采用双抗体夹心酶联免疫吸附法检测两组术前及AMI组术后24 h血清内脂素水平;应用心脏超声测量各组左心室射血分数(LVEF)、左心室舒张末期内径(LVEDD)。结果 AMI组各时间点血清内脂素水平(术前:80.82±7.63μg/L,术后24 h:91.96±7.37μg/L)均显著高于对照组(19.32±4.37μg/L),且AMI组术后24 h血清内脂素水平较术前明显升高,差异均有统计学意义(P0.01)。不同冠状动脉病变支数血清内脂素水平分别为:单支:72.85±2.56μg/L,双支:82.24±5.77μg/L,多支:88.22±6.07μg/L;不同冠状动脉狭窄程度血清内脂素水平分别为:轻度:74.58±4.40μg/L,中度:80.13±4.71μg/L,重度:87.57±6.39μg/L;组间比较差异均有统计学意义(P0.05)。与对照组相比,AMI组LVEF明显降低(P0.01),LVEDD无显著差异。AMI组血清内脂素水平与冠状动脉病变支数、冠状动脉病变Gensini积分呈正相关(r=0.754,r=0.672,P0.01),与LVEF呈负相关(r=-0.459,P0.01)。结论血清内脂素水平可以作为推测AMI患者冠状动脉病变严重程度的指标。  相似文献

The release of the adipocytokine visfatin is regulated by glucose and insulin   总被引:25,自引:0,他引:25  
Aims/hypothesis The novel insulin-mimetic adipocytokine visfatin has been linked to the metabolic syndrome, but its regulation has not been characterised to date. Since insulin-mimetic actions of visfatin may be part of the feedback regulation of glucose homeostasis, we hypothesised that visfatin concentrations are influenced by glucose or insulin blood levels in humans.Subjects, materials and methods In this randomised, double-blind, placebo-controlled crossover study, nine healthy male subjects (age 26±6 years) attended three different study days. On each day, systemic glucose concentrations of 5.0, 8.3 and 11.1 mmol/l were attained by stepwise increases in i.v. infusions of glucose, representing fasting and postprandial conditions. Visfatin plasma concentrations were studied during concomitant exogenous hyperinsulinaemia, inhibition of endogenous insulin production by somatostatin infusion, and placebo time control. Additionally, human adipocytes were cultured to study visfatin release and mRNA expression in vitro.Results Glucose concentrations of 8.3 and 11.1 mmol/l increased circulating visfatin from baseline concentrations of 0.5±0.0 ng/ml to 0.9±0.1 and 2.1±0.3 ng/ml, respectively (p<0.01). Glucose-induced elevation of visfatin was prevented by co-infusion of insulin or somatostatin (p<0.05). Cultured subcutaneous and visceral adipocytes released an equivalent amount of visfatin upon glucose-concentration- and time-dependent stimulation. Visfatin secretion involved the phosphatidylinositol 3-kinase (PI3-kinase) and protein kinase B (AKT) pathways. The mRNA expression pattern of visfatin was consistent with this altered protein release.Conclusions/interpretation Circulating visfatin concentrations are increased by hyperglycaemia. This effect is suppressed by exogenous hyperinsulinaemia or somatostatin infusion. Glucose signalling for visfatin release in adipocytes involves the PI3-kinase/AKT pathway.  相似文献

73例2型糖尿病患者,根据颈动脉内中膜厚度(IMT)分为动脉粥样硬化(AS)组和非AS组,测定血浆内脂素水平.结果 显示,2型糖尿病AS组内脂素水平高于非AS组[(44.95±10.14对34.52±9.08)μg/L,P<0.05],均高于对照组[(24.46±7.18)μg/L,均P<0.05],并与IMT、腰臀比、内脏脂肪厚度、空腹胰岛素、胰岛素抵抗指数呈正相关.年龄、病程、HbA_(1c)及内脂素是影响颈动脉IMT的相关因素.  相似文献

3T3-L1细胞促分化成熟后,分别以酯酰辅酶A胆固醇酯酰转移酶(ACAT)抑制剂(2μg/ml)和不同浓度(0、25、50、75和100 μg/ml)的氧化型低密度脂蛋白(ox-LDL)干预48 h,ACAT抑制剂(2μg/ml)和ox-LDL( 50 μg/ml)干预0、6、18、36和48 h,ACAT抑制剂(2μg/ml)、ox-LDL( 50 μg/ml)和不同浓度(0、100、200和400 μmol/L)的牛磺酸熊去氧胆酸(TUDCA)干预48 h.用ELISA法检测细胞上清内脂素的水平,Western印迹法检测脂肪细胞总蛋白GRP78和CHOP表达.ACAT抑制剂和不同浓度的ox-LDL干预脂肪细胞48 h后,随着ox-LDL浓度的增加,脂肪细胞内胆固醇浓度、GRP78和CHOP蛋白表达及内脂素水平显著升高,实验组与空白对照组比较,差异均具有统计学意义(均P<0.05);ACAT抑制剂和ox-LDL干预后,随干预时间的延长,脂肪细胞GRP78、CHOP蛋白表达及内脂素水平均显著升高,实验组与空白对照组比较,差异均有统计学意义(均P<0.05);ACAT抑制剂、ox-LDL和不同浓度TUDCA干预48 h后,脂肪细胞GRP78及CHOP蛋白表达水平及内脂素水平逐渐降低,实验组(200和400 μmol/L)与空白对照组比较,差异均有统计学意义(均P<0.05).脂肪细胞胆固醇负荷增加可促进脂肪细胞分泌内脂素,其机制可能与脂肪细胞的内质网应激增强有关.  相似文献

BackgroundEndothelial dysfunction (ED) is closely linked to cardiovascular disease and outcome in patients with chronic kidney disease (CKD). Visfatin is an adipocytokine that recently generated much interest; however, its role in CKD remains to be clarified. This study aimed to assess visfatin in correlation with markers of ED and inflammation in Egyptian patients with CKD.MethodsThe study included 40 non-diabetic, clinically stable CKD patients and 20 healthy volunteers. Serum levels of visfatin, markers of ED (intercellular adhesion molecule-1 (ICAM-1) and vascular cell adhesion molecule-1 (VCAM-1)) and markers of inflammation (interleukin-6 (IL-6), and C-reactive protein (CRP)) were measured. Endothelial function was evaluated using brachial artery flow-mediated dilatation (FMD).ResultsSerum visfatin, ICAM-1, VCAM-1, CRP, and IL-6 levels were significantly elevated and FMD% was decreased in CKD patients as compared to controls. Visfatin correlated positively with ICAM-1, VCAM-1, CRP, and IL-6 and negatively with FMD% in CKD patients. In a multiple regression model, visfatin was strongly and independently associated with FMD (Beta = ?0.02, P < 0.001) in CKD patients.ConclusionsSerum visfatin is strongly associated with endothelial adhesion molecules and FMD%, suggesting that visfatin is an important promising biomarker for prediction of ED and future cardiovascular risk in CKD patients. Moreover, the relationship between visfatin and IL-6 indicates that circulating visfatin may reflect the sub-clinical inflammatory status. Thus, visfatin might be involved in the complex interactions between ED, inflammation, and atherosclerosis and their major clinical consequences; however, further prospective studies are required to prove this hypothesis.  相似文献

目的探讨社区获得性肺炎(CAP)患者血浆内脂素浓度对疾病预后的相关价值。方法收集112例健康体检者和112例CAP患者外周血样本,采用酶联免疫吸附试验法检测所有样本血浆内脂素浓度,分析CAP患者血浆内脂素浓度与动脉血氧分压、氧合指数、血白细胞计数、血浆c反应蛋白浓度、肺炎严重指数和急性病生理学和长期健康评价(APACHE)Ⅱ评分的相关程度,并进行Logistic回归分析。采用ROC曲线分析血浆内脂素浓度对CAP患者入院后30d内死亡的预测价值。结果CAP患者血浆内脂素浓度较健康体检者明显增高(t=19.538,P〈0.001)。CAP患者血浆内脂素浓度与动脉血氧分惬(r=-0.451,P〈0.05)、氧合指数(r=-0.473,P〈0.05)、血白细胞计数(r=0.412,P〈0.05)、血浆C-反应蛋白浓度(r=0.501,P〈0.05)、肺炎严重指数(r=0.541,P〈0.05)和APACHEⅡ评分(r=0.528,P〈0.05)均有显著相关。Logistic回归分析显示,血浆内脂素浓度(OR=1.242,95%CI=1.101~2.387,P〈0.001)、肺炎严重指数(OR=1.209,95%CI:1.081,-1.749,P〈0.001)及APACHEⅡ评分(OR=1.368,95%CI=1.107~2.023,P〈0.001)是CAP患者住院后30d内死亡的独立危险因素。ROC曲线分析显示,血浆内脂素浓度对CAP患者住院后30d内死亡有显著预测价值(曲线下面积为0.869,95%CI=0.792.0.925,P〈0.001)。结论内脂素参与社区获得性肺炎的全身炎症反应,血浆内脂素浓度与CAP的预后显著相关。  相似文献

目的:探讨内脂素(visfatin)与体质量指数(BMI)、血脂[甘油三酯(TG)、总胆固醇(TC)]、胰岛素抵抗(IR)的关系。方法采用电化学发光法和酶联免疫吸附法(ELISA)以及全自动生化仪分别测定52例妊娠期糖尿病孕妇(GDM组)和52例糖耐量正常孕妇(NGT组)的空腹血糖(FPG)、空腹胰岛素(FINS)、visfatin水平。计算BMI和胰岛素抵抗指数(IRI)。结果①GDM组孕妇BMI明显高于NGT组,差异有统计学意义(P<0.05)。②GDM组孕妇TG高于NGT组,差异有统计学意义(P<0.05);两组孕妇TC比较差异无统计学意义(P>0.05)。③GDM组孕妇FPG、FINS、visfatin、IRI均高于NGT组,差异有统计学意义(P<0.05)。结论 GDM孕妇血清visfatin水平明显升高,与机体针对甘油三酯升高和胰岛素抵抗产生的代偿反应有关。  相似文献

Plasma visfatin levels in normal weight women with polycystic ovary syndrome   总被引:10,自引:0,他引:10  
BACKGROUND: The present study was designed to measure plasma visfatin levels in normal weight women with polycystic ovary syndrome (PCOS) and to assess possible correlations between visfatin and the hormonal or metabolic parameters of the syndrome. METHODS: Twenty-five normal weight [body mass index (BMI)<25 kg/m(2)] women with PCOS, 24 obese and overweight (BMI>25 kg/m(2)) controls (ovulating women without clinical or biochemical hyperandrogenism), and 24 normal weight controls were studied. Blood samples were collected between the 3rd and the 7th days of a menstrual cycle in the control groups and during a spontaneous bleeding episode in the PCOS groups at 9:00 A.M., after an overnight fast. Circulating levels of LH, FSH, prolactin (PRL), testosterone (T), Delta(4)-androstenedione (Delta(4)-Alpha), dehydroepiandrosterone sulfate (DHEA-S), 17alpha-OH-progesterone (17OH-P), sex hormone-binding globulin (SHBG), insulin, glucose, and visfatin were measured. RESULTS: Plasma visfatin levels and the visfatin-to-insulin ratio were significantly lower in normal weight controls than in both normal weight women with PCOS and overweight or obese controls. The visfatin-to-insulin ratio was significantly higher in normal weight women with PCOS than in overweight or obese controls. Plasma visfatin levels were found to be positively correlated with LH and Delta(4)A levels, as well as with free androgen index (FAI) values, and negatively correlated with SHBG. LH and SHBG levels were found to be the only independent significant determinants of circulating visfatin. In the control groups, plasma visfatin levels were significantly correlated with BMI, waist (W) measurement, and waist-to-hip ratio (WHR). CONCLUSIONS: Visfatin levels are positively associated with obesity in healthy women of reproductive age. Moreover, the present study indicates, for the first time, a possible involvement of increased visfatin levels in PCOS-associated metabolic and hormonal disturbances.  相似文献

目的研究内脂素对巨噬细胞中组织因子(TF)和纤溶酶原激活物抑制剂-1(PAI-1)表达的影响及可能的机制。方法体外培养的THP-1细胞中加入不同浓度的内脂素(包括空白对照,50ng/ml,100ng/ml三个浓度组),每组分别孵育6小时,12小时和24小时各3个时间点。同时设立2-羟基萘甲基磷酸三乙酸甲基酯(HNMPA;100umol/L)组。将各组细胞进行realtime PCR和Western blot检测,比较各组TF和PAI-1表达的情况。结果内脂素增加巨噬细胞中TF和PAI-1的mRNA转录和蛋白质表达水平,HNMPA不影响内脂素的这些效应。结论内脂素促进巨噬细胞向促血栓表型转化,机制与胰岛素受体相关的途径无关。  相似文献
